One is the ultimate, legendary "insult comic" who plays off of his audiences, never shying away from calling them "hockey pucks" and "dummies". An actor in both comedic and dramatic roles, he was the voice of the lovable Mr. Potato Head, in the Toy Story movies. The other is one of the world's most beloved comedians. His lighting-like, spot-on improvisations are the stuff of legend. His frenetic and daring performance style, along with his wide-ranging movie and TV roles, made him an Icon.
Together there WILL BE LAUGHTER! To experience the humor of Michael Walter as Don Rickles and David Born as Robin Williams is to be enveloped in all of their insanely brilliant comedy. Their tributes are jaw-dropping in their authenticity.


Award winning Elvis Tribute Artist Peter Alden, along with his band, The Corvairs, performing live! Special guest stars include tributes to Ed Sullivan, Marilyn Monroe and Buddy Holly. Peter Alden is keeping the classics alive with second-to-none performances paying tribute to the King of Rock n Roll - Elvis Presley. Fans all over the world who've seen his tribute, not only appreciate Peter's talent and dedication, but rank his tribute to Elvis as one of the absolute best in the world! The Corvairs band (including George Trullinger on guitar, Larry Cornwell on keys, Gregg Gagnon on bass and Keith Coville on drums) have performed all over Florida to standing ovations.
